This work recounts the story of Henry Perry, one of the most notable and admirable figures in the missionary saga which took place between the French Revolution and the beginning of World War I. This story tells of Perry's missionary labors in the ancient land of Armenia, his comings and goings across the Atlantic, the death of five daughters and then his beloved wife in Turkey, his resilience and courage as a follower of Jesus Christ.
